摘要: 本文主要的工作為製作一簡單使用的安裝配件(submount),以完成光電元 件與光纖的耦合作業。安裝配件使用的材料為矽晶片,並通過半導體製程 方法完成。配件上將提供自動對準功能,以減短一般耦合程序上耗費的時 間。文中並針對自動對準機制作測試,以了解自動對準的經過與準確度。 最後把安裝配件應用在面射型雷射(SEL)與光纖的耦合包裝,其結果能達 到90%的耦合率。 A simple and useful Si-Submount was constructed and used to finished the coupling between an opto-electronic device and an optical fiber. Submount is made of Si(100)-wafer, in according to the mature silicon fabrication technique. One of its significant function, self-alignment, was to reduce the time consuming during active alignment which was required in case light coupling into an fiber-core. Testing on the accuracy of self-alignment was performed with the submount we made and LED devices. Finally, we conduct the whole self-aligned packaging among SEL device, submount and optical fiber, and obtained an coupling efficiency up to 90%.
